| CARRICK-ON-SUIR, a market town of Co. Tipperary, Ireland,
in the east parliamentary division, on the north (left) bank of the Suir,
43/4 m. W.N.W. from Waterford by the Waterford & Limerick line of
the Great Southern & Western railway. It was formerly a walled town,
and contains some ancient buildings, such as the castle, erected in 1309,
formerly a seat of the dukes of Onnonde, now belonging to the Butler family,
a branch of which takes the title of earl from the town. On the other
side of the river, connected by a bridge of the 14th century, and another
of modern erection, stands the suburb of Carrickbeg, in county Waterford,
where an abbey was founded in 336. The woollen manufactures for which
the town was formerly famous are extinct. A thriving export trade is carried
on in agricultural produce, condensed milk is manufactured, and slate
is extensively quarried in the neighborhood, while some coal is exported
from the neighboring fields. Dredging has improved the navigable channel
of the river, which is tidal to this point and is lined with quays. |
